Sam Anderson: Career, Work, and Public Profile

Overview and Identity

Sam Anderson is an American actor best known for his steady work in television and film since the 1980s. This profile focuses on the performer whose credits include recurring and guest roles across multiple genres. It distinguishes him from other individuals named Sam Anderson, such as the writer and academic, by concentrating on verifiable screen credits and professional milestones in entertainment.

Notable Acting Roles and Television Work

Sam Anderson’s television work includes long-running and series regular roles that establish his presence in ongoing narratives. He appeared as Mr. Langley on Perfect Strangers, a role that contributed to the show’s family-oriented humor and supporting cast. He portrayed Principal Porter on Heroes, adding gravity to the serialized drama within the superhero genre. Additional notable television credits include appearances on Star Trek: The Next Generation, Star Trek: Voyager, and Seinfeld, demonstrating consistent casting across iconic series.
